How they compare

Mauritania currently reports 35.12 deaths per 1,000 people against 33.93 deaths per 1,000 people in Kenya, a difference of 1.19 deaths per 1,000 people.

Across all 74 years both countries report, Mauritania has been ahead every year.

Kenya ranks 46th and Mauritania ranks 43rd of 236 countries.

Mauritania has averaged higher in every one of the 8 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Kenya Mauritania Difference Ahead
1950s 160.42 deaths per 1,000 people 215.16 deaths per 1,000 people 54.74 deaths per 1,000 people Mauritania
1960s 117.58 deaths per 1,000 people 174.66 deaths per 1,000 people 57.08 deaths per 1,000 people Mauritania
1970s 95.28 deaths per 1,000 people 148.05 deaths per 1,000 people 52.78 deaths per 1,000 people Mauritania
1980s 75.79 deaths per 1,000 people 117.18 deaths per 1,000 people 41.39 deaths per 1,000 people Mauritania
1990s 78.75 deaths per 1,000 people 93.73 deaths per 1,000 people 14.98 deaths per 1,000 people Mauritania
2000s 58.58 deaths per 1,000 people 66.92 deaths per 1,000 people 8.34 deaths per 1,000 people Mauritania
2010s 39.96 deaths per 1,000 people 45.09 deaths per 1,000 people 5.13 deaths per 1,000 people Mauritania
2020s 35.04 deaths per 1,000 people 36.74 deaths per 1,000 people 1.7 deaths per 1,000 people Mauritania

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
